The Fourth aiCAMstir Meeting was held online on 10 March 2022 with 30 attendees.

Agenda

Agenda of the Fourth aiCAMstir Meeting

The agenda of the 120 min long on-line meeting was as follows:

  • Welcome and introduction (2-3 sentences each)
  • Stephan Kallee (AluStir): One-to-One Collaborations, Grant Applications and Collaborative Papers
  • Michael Hasieber and Pascal Pöthig (TU Ilmenau): Wear of FSW Tools and Possibilities of Process Monitoring (20 min + 5 min questions)
  • Francois Nadeau (NRC): How Immersed Bath Ultrasounds (NDE) Qualification is Embedded in FSW Projects at NRC (20 min + 5 min questions)
  • Tim Haynie (Bond Technologies Inc.): Products and Services of Bond (20 min + 5 min questions)
  • Mike Lewis (FTS Engineering Answers Ltd): Organisational Comments and Date of Fifth aiCAMstir Meeting (9 June 2022 at the same time slot)

One-to-One Collaborations, Grant Applications and Collaborative Papers

So far, Stirline GmbH, Bond Technologies Inc, UQTR (Canada), National Research Council Canada, National Chung Cheng University, University of Waterloo, University of Applied Sciences of Southern Switzerland (SUPSI), Prince Sattam bin Abdulaziz University, TRAC-C industrie, JACKY, LAMEF, Indian Institute of Technology Kharagpur, DriveConcepts GmbH, Sandeep, Smart Industry Group, BIL-IBS, Brigham Young University, Institut Spawalnictwa, OxCAM Engineering Arc, Sabe Technology Ltd, Transforming Stress Ltd, FTS Engineering Answers Ltd and AluStir have signed-up as project participants, as shown in the list of project partipants. The project is open for further project participants. Please contact stephan.kallee@alustir.com, if you want to contribute to this project.

Several projects participants teamed-up for industrially funded contract R&D work on a one-to-one basis. Some of the results of this work will be published on www.aicamstir.com, whil other results will be kept confidential.

It is also possible and encouraged to set-up government funded sub projects, e.g. on using automated in-line shearography for closed-loop parameter control during FSW of thermoplastics in the high-volume production of battery trays.
